Within the realm of spirituality, the Mata ki chowki Vaishno Devi darshan yatra stands as a journey that allows devotees to immerse themselves in the rich history and traditions of Hindu pilgrimage. Every year, scores of trekkers embark on this remarkable hike, which encompasses an uphill trek of approximately 12 kilometers to access the shrine. This pilgrimage is particularly significant during the Navratri festival, when the temple sees an influx of pilgrims seeking blessings. Visitors are encouraged to embrace the local culture by enjoying local delicacies and participating in evening aarti sessions at the temple premises. For those looking to expand their itinerary, the vibrant town of Katra offers convenience for accommodation and amenities. Exploring the nearby Ardh Kuwari Cave, where devotees can take a moment to pause before the final ascent, adds depth to the experience. What is the significance of Mata Ki Chowki during the Vaishno Devi Darshan Yatra? +
Mata Ki Chowki is a customary devotional gathering that involves singing bhajans and performing rituals in honor of Goddess Vaishno Devi. It serves as a spiritual prelude to the pilgrimage, creating a communal atmosphere for devotees to share their faith and devotion while enhancing their Yatra experience.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Vaishno Devi is from March to October, when the weather is pleasant and suitable for the yatra. March-June is ideal for comfortable trekking, while September-October offers fewer crowds after the monsoon. Winters (November-February) are very cold with possible snowfall but are preferred by devotees seeking a peaceful darshan. Navratri periods attract heavy crowds and require advance planning.

Nearest Airport / Railway Station

  • Jammu Airport (Satwari Airport - IXJ) 50 km
  • Shri Mata Vaishno Devi Katra Railway Station (SVDK) 2-3 kms
